Re: Should I convert to ext3?



On Sat, Oct 12, 2002 at 12:10:17PM -0400, Chip Rose wrote:
> As a new Debian3.0 user, I've seen posts about converting to ext3 or
> another type filesystem.  I don't know anything about this, but if it
> would make my single-user computer more stable, I might want to try it. 

Give it a go, then.

> Are there significant benefits, to outweigh the "risks" of me possibly
> hosing my system?  I went to the following links, and didn't see much in
> the way of advocacy or potential upsides.

You get journalling, so crash recovery is a few seconds rather than a
the better part of an hour for today's large hard disks.  It's fairly
quick, and it's difficult for anyone with an IQ greater than a brick
to screw up conversion.
